Output dac5df30336bd0f9ec6161b94a28ea743dcfeb9dc0280019a6cb7f31b0d3ea6a:0

value
73371
script pubkey
OP_0 OP_PUSHBYTES_20 f2acc6e50128848205f3d3b1189a70cceac1a57f
address
bc1q72kvdegp9zzgyp0n6wc33xnsen4vrftl2gaayk
transaction
dac5df30336bd0f9ec6161b94a28ea743dcfeb9dc0280019a6cb7f31b0d3ea6a
confirmations
305394
spent
true